Output 3fa282d864d990427c67b3051552f2d982e372566c8d4e75a57d6d9b9732f2aa:8

value
43568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612dcf1774c54a319f0ec18416c6eb9ea5be1ae3 OP_EQUAL
address
3AYrM1iCrjjCT8hhS7p3Zym1wQ1yMFse93
transaction
3fa282d864d990427c67b3051552f2d982e372566c8d4e75a57d6d9b9732f2aa
spent
true